What has been my experience with Imposter Syndrome? There are feelings in life that come up in different situations and phases. For me, the feeling that I may not deserve to be where I am or that I am not as smart as everyone around me is one that comes up sometimes. Although I know that I deserve to be here and that I have worked extremely hard to get this far, this is still an ongoing challenge for me. Some of the situations when the feelings come up include when I experience huge success, make a major transition in my life or achieve something I have been working on for long.
